Despite the significant growth potential, the crop planting management system market faces several challenges. The high initial investment cost of acquiring and implementing these systems can be a major barrier, particularly for smallholder farmers in developing countries. Lack of awareness and digital literacy among some farming communities can also hinder adoption, requiring extensive training and support programs. Data security and privacy concerns associated with collecting and transmitting sensitive agricultural data are also emerging issues needing careful consideration. Integration challenges with existing farm management systems and infrastructure can also impede seamless adoption. Furthermore, the complexity of these systems can sometimes present operational challenges requiring specialized expertise and skilled labor, which can limit adoption in some areas. The reliance on robust internet connectivity in many systems represents a significant hurdle in regions with limited network availability. Addressing these challenges through targeted policies, affordable financing options, and user-friendly interfaces will be vital in unlocking the full potential of the crop planting management system market.

Software Segment Dominance: The software segment is expected to dominate the market due to its versatility and scalability. It offers functionalities such as farm management, predictive analytics, and remote monitoring, driving efficiency and optimizing resource utilization. The integration of AI and machine learning capabilities within software solutions further enhances their value proposition, enabling data-driven decision-making and precise management of planting operations.
Oilseed Application Growth: The oilseed application segment is experiencing notable growth due to the high value and global demand for oilseeds like soybeans, sunflowers, and canola. Precise planting management helps optimize yields and quality, contributing significantly to profitability in this crucial agricultural sector. The increasing focus on sustainable agricultural practices further fuels this segment's expansion.
Hardware Component Importance: While software holds a dominant position, the hardware component plays a critical role, including precision planters, sensors, and GPS systems. These hardware components are essential for data acquisition and execution of planting strategies, creating an interdependent relationship with software solutions. Advancements in hardware technology, such as improved sensor accuracy and automation capabilities, are continuously driving market expansion.
